There’s a fish with your name on it in Bridgetown and Bluefin Fishing will help you catch it! With Captain Jett at the helm, you’re in knowledgeable and experienced hands.
You’re likely to fish for Wahoo, Great Barracuda, Mahi Mahi, Blue Marlin, Sailfish, Blackfin Tuna, Bonito, Horse-eye Jack, Almaco Jack, and more with any luck. During the trip, you might be spinning, trolling, jigging, or maybe something more specialized in this area.
Capt. Jett welcomes anglers of all ages, including kids, so get ‘em offline and onto the water! Children must wear life vests, so find out if the appropriate size is available on board. Snacks are also a good idea so that nobody gets cranky on an empty stomach!
You’ll be casting lines from a 27’ Panga with space for 4 passengers. It comes with outriggers, downriggers, and all the essentials no fishing machine can run without. You’ll find rods, reels, and tackle waiting for you, along with lures. Live bait is on offer, but it’s good to ask about this so you know if you’ll be catching it yourself.
A First Mate will be there to make sure everything is running smoothly.
Before coming aboard, it will be necessary to buy a local fishing license for everyone in your group. This information is usually available online, or you can ask the captain. Some species might be protected or require a tag to keep them, so make sure you know what to expect. Some essentials to bring are sunglasses, and sunblock (non-spray). Drinks will be available for you. Alcohol is allowed in moderation, but you should avoid hard liquor as well as glass bottles.
